Description

The Teutonic Castle in Olsztynek is a fascinating monument of medieval Gothic architecture, built between 1349 and 1366 by Günter von Hohenstein, a komtur of the Teutonic Order.

Situated on a hill, the castle played a strategic role during the Polish-Teutonic wars and was captured by Polish troops in 1410. Its rectangular plan with a tower and outer walls and underground vaulted cellars delights history buffs.

Today, part of the castle is integrated into the school building, giving it a unique character combining past and present.
